Opher, I lived in Rotterdam for three years from late 1977 to late 1980. It was the first place I ever had real money in my pocket! I still have a soft spot for it and its people.
But all this re-building is recent. The nazis destroyed all the buildings in central Rotterdam, apart from the town hall, in one day in May 1940. Everything had to be re-built afterwards; and it was (as you’d expect) shoddy. That’s why there has been so much re-building in the last decade or so. I do hope that the recent builds are more durable than their predecessors.
